Abstract
Systems and methods for providing real-time data and performing network transactions via a GUI over a network using computer-based storage and retrieval schemes including real-time lookup tables and databases and updating the real-time lookup tables and databases in real-time, with the network including but not limited to Internet, phone, wireless communications, and other channels.

A method for retrieving electronic data over a network in real-time and displaying the electronic data in a graphical user interface (GUI) comprising the steps of:
providing an external network and an Interchange Rate Based Convenience Fee, Service Fee, and Surcharge System in external network communication with Fee Creation Entities, wherein the Interchange Rate Based Convenience Fee, Service Fee, and Surcharge System maintains a profile database including fee tables and/or other computer-based storage schemes for fee data storage, and wherein the Interchange Rate Based Convenience Fee, Service Fee, and Surcharge System is operable to add, modify and delete fee tables whenever new fee data is received from the Fee Creation Entities over the external network;
initiating a transaction by a cardholder via an Electronic Payment User Interface on the GUI;
receiving electronic transaction information corresponding to an account of the cardholder and an original payment amount for the cardholder;
automatically making a real-time lookup in the profile database for a real-time interchange rate associated with the account of the cardholder;
automatically determining a convenience fee by combining the real-time interchange rate with other fees, wherein the convenience fee is dynamically determined; and
calculating a total transaction amount for the cardholder, wherein the total transaction amount includes the original payment amount plus the convenience fee for the cardholder, wherein the total transaction amount payable by the cardholder is greater than the original payment amount or equal to the original payment amount.
- The method of claim 1, wherein the real-time lookup is a real-time bank identification number (BIN) lookup, wherein attributes of the received electronic transaction information are detected including issuing bank, credit or debit card type, business or individual card, wherein a real-time interchange rate is determined based on the detected attributes.
- The method of claim 1, wherein the steps are repeated until a step of receiving an approval input from the cardholder to process the transaction.
- The method of claim 1, wherein the profile database includes a logical table including a plurality of logical rows and a plurality of logical columns to look up, store, and present real-time data, wherein each logical column corresponds to a convenience fee or components of a convenience free, wherein each logical row is associated with a separate account, wherein automatically making the real-time lookup in the profile database for the real-time interchange rate associated with the account of the cardholder includes looking up the real-time interchange rate using the plurality of logical rows and the plurality of logical columns.
- The method of claim 1, further comprising presenting the convenience fee to the cardholder with a transparent indication of itemized components of the convenience fee, wherein the step of presenting a transparent indication includes a visual representation of a comparison between the itemized components included in the convenience fee and those of a multiplicity of alternative card types and/or issuing banks with lower convenience fees.
- The method of claim 1, wherein the other fees include fees from the fee creation entities, wherein the fee creation entities include an acquiring bank, a payment processor, and a card association.
- The method of claim 1, wherein the itemized components include at least one of the following fees: real-time interchange fee, dues and assessments, service provider fee(s), and combinations thereof.
- The method of claim 5, further including the step of providing alternative credit card or debit card types that have a corresponding lower convenience fee, wherein the alternative credit or debit card types include a new cardholder account, wherein the corresponding lower convenience fee is a lower convenience fee on the transaction for the new cardholder account, further comprising the step of issuing the cardholder the new cardholder account for use in the transaction.
